Advantages of Using Acrylate Emulsion in Paints and Coatings
Acrylate emulsion is a versatile and widely used material in the paint and coatings industry. It is a type of water-based emulsion that contains acrylic polymers, making it an excellent choice for various applications. There are several advantages to using acrylate emulsion in paints and coatings, which make it a popular choice among manufacturers and consumers alike.
One of the key advantages of acrylate emulsion is its excellent adhesion properties. Acrylic polymers have a strong affinity for a wide range of substrates, including metal, wood, concrete, and plastic. This means that paints and coatings formulated with acrylate emulsion can adhere firmly to surfaces, providing long-lasting protection and durability. Whether used on interior walls, exterior facades, or industrial equipment, acrylate emulsion-based coatings offer superior adhesion compared to other types of emulsions.
In addition to adhesion, acrylate emulsion also offers excellent weather resistance. Acrylic polymers are known for their ability to withstand harsh environmental conditions, such as UV radiation, moisture, and temperature fluctuations. This makes paints and coatings formulated with acrylate emulsion ideal for outdoor applications, where they can provide long-term protection against fading, cracking, and peeling. Whether used on residential homes, commercial buildings, or automotive surfaces, acrylate emulsion-based coatings can maintain their appearance and performance even in challenging weather conditions.
Another advantage of using acrylate emulsion in paints and coatings is its versatility. Acrylic polymers can be easily modified to achieve specific performance characteristics, such as flexibility, hardness, or gloss. This allows manufacturers to tailor the properties of their coatings to meet the requirements of different applications and substrates. Whether a high-gloss finish is desired for a decorative wall paint or a flexible coating is needed for a metal roof, acrylate emulsion can be formulated to deliver the desired performance.
Furthermore, acrylate emulsion is environmentally friendly. As a water-based material, it contains minimal volatile organic compounds (VOCs), which are harmful pollutants that can contribute to air pollution and health problems. By using acrylate emulsion-based paints and coatings, manufacturers can reduce their environmental impact and comply with regulations on VOC emissions. Additionally, acrylate emulsion is easy to clean up with water, making it a convenient and eco-friendly choice for both professionals and DIY enthusiasts.

How to Properly Apply Acrylate Emulsion in Construction Projects
Acrylate emulsion is a versatile material that is commonly used in construction projects for various applications. It is a type of water-based emulsion that contains acrylic polymers, making it an ideal choice for a wide range of projects due to its durability, flexibility, and ease of application. When properly applied, acrylate emulsion can provide a long-lasting and high-quality finish that can withstand the elements and protect surfaces from damage.
One of the key benefits of using acrylate emulsion in construction projects is its ability to adhere to a variety of surfaces, including concrete, wood, metal, and masonry. This makes it a versatile option for a wide range of applications, from sealing and waterproofing to protecting surfaces from UV damage and weathering. Additionally, acrylate emulsion is resistant to mold and mildew growth, making it an ideal choice for areas that are prone to moisture and humidity.
When applying acrylate emulsion, it is important to follow the manufacturer’s instructions carefully to ensure a successful application. Before applying the emulsion, surfaces should be clean, dry, and free of any debris or contaminants that could affect adhesion. Any cracks or holes should be repaired and sealed prior to application to ensure a smooth and even finish.
To apply acrylate emulsion, it is recommended to use a brush, roller, or sprayer, depending on the size and complexity of the project. The emulsion should be applied in thin, even coats to achieve the desired coverage and thickness. It is important to allow each coat to dry completely before applying additional coats to prevent bubbling or peeling.
When applying acrylate emulsion to vertical surfaces, it is important to work from the top down to prevent drips and runs. It is also recommended to apply the emulsion in overlapping strokes to ensure even coverage and avoid streaks or uneven patches. For horizontal surfaces, it is best to apply the emulsion in long, even strokes to achieve a smooth and uniform finish.
After applying the acrylate emulsion, it is important to allow sufficient time for it to dry and cure before exposing it to foot traffic or other elements. The drying time will vary depending on the temperature, humidity, and thickness of the application, so it is important to refer to the manufacturer’s guidelines for specific recommendations.
